Here are 42 Ocala-area volleyball players you should watch in 2023
Marion County has long produced collegiate volleyball players. Just last year, 11 players from around the county signed to play at colleges around the country.
There's no shortage of talent coming in the 2023 season. Mississippi State commit McKenna Yates of Trinity Catholic headlines a talented group of players in Ocala preparing for another year of playoff runs.
